How to buy back sold items
Getting back your sold items in Diablo 4 is a simple process, and just requires you to use the Buyback option at a vendor you've recently sold an item too.
Here's the process for buying back your sold items in Diablo 4:
- Head to any vendor and interact with them.
- Once the side menu appears, select the 'Purchase' tab.
- At the bottom of the menu will be an option called "Switch to Buyback"; select this by pressing the highlighted button.
- A new list of items will appear that you previously sold to the vendor.
- Select the item you want and confirm the purchase to get them back.
The prices of buyback items should be the same as what you sold them for, so you won't need to worry about being scalped instantly by the vendor.
It's worth noting that if you sell an item to a vendor and then exit the game, upon loading the game back up the item will be lost forever.
